The True Cost of Going It Alone
Numerous individuals assume they can handle their own individual injury claims, particularly if liability appears specific. Nevertheless, Accident Law Firm USA law is hardly ever simple. Insurer are multi-billion-dollar corporations with advanced legal teams whose primary objective is to minimize payouts or reject claims altogether.
Without legal representation, injured parties regularly fall into typical traps, such as:
- Giving taped statements that are later on utilized versus them.
- Accepting early settlement provides that do not cover long-term healthcare.
- Failing to collect or maintain vital proof.
- Missing important legal due dates (statutes of limitations).
An experienced injury lawyer comprehends these techniques and levels the playing field, guaranteeing that victims are not taken advantage of during their time of requirement.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)1. How much does it cost to employ an injury lawyer?
Most personal injury attorneys run on a contingency fee basis. This means there are no in advance expenses or hourly charges. Instead, the attorney takes an agreed-upon percentage of the last settlement or court award. If they do not win the case, the customer owes no attorney fees.

4. What kinds of damages can I recuperate?
Victims can generally look for payment for two primary categories of damages:
- Economic Damages: Medical costs, future medical treatments, rehab expenses, lost incomes, and property damage.
- Non-Economic Damages: Pain and suffering, emotional trauma, disfigurement, and loss of consortium.
